There are at least six bands with the name King Bee. 1. A hip-hop band. 2. A psychedelic rock artist from Virginia. 3. A punk band with Fred Cole as singer. 4. A post-pop band from Belgium 5. A funk based band from Newcastle, UK. 6. A blues-rock band. 1. A hip hop-band from the Netherlands that started out in 1989. They are best known for their hits “Back By Dope Demand” and "Must bee the music", both from the album "Royal Jelly". 2. Psychedelic music artist Josh Collins (Formerly of Motherboard! Motherboard!) 3. A project by 60's and 70's garage rock musician Fred Cole. He released one 7" in 1978 under this moniker. 4. A rather psychedelic post-rock band founded in Antwerp, Belgium. 5. A funk based band that also encompass jazz and rock. Additional info http://kingbeefunk.com/ 6. A modern blues-rock band from Miami, Florida. Their music is available for free on their website here: King Bee.
